Summary: The IT Support Engineer (SC Cleared) role involves providing essential IT support at a key client site in St. Andrews, ensuring service levels are maintained and end users are supported. The position requires daily on-site presence and focuses on managing IT support tickets, hardware repairs, and asset management. Candidates must possess active SC clearance and have experience in secure environments. This is a short-term assignment from 5th September to 30th September.
Key Responsibilities:
- Manage and respond to IT support tickets for the local hub and surrounding spokes, ensuring SLAs are met.
- Maintain accurate stock control and asset management, including scanning equipment in and out of hub locations.
- Handle hardware repairs for in-warranty devices and coordinate with vendors for parts, replacements, and returns.
- Process IT equipment disposals in line with contractual obligations.
- Replenish IT lockers as needed.
- Support hardware rollouts, deployments, and break-fix activities.
- Flag potential service issues or improvement opportunities to the team leader.
- Adhere to all site regulations and internal processes.
Key Skills:
- Strong working knowledge of Windows OS and Office 365.
- Experience with Intel-based hardware and device maintenance.
- Proven break/fix support experience.
- Hands-on experience with hardware troubleshooting, rollouts, and deployments.
- Confident working with laptops, including setup and imaging.
- Excellent communication and organisational skills.
- Ability to work independently and manage tasks efficiently.
- Active SC Clearance is required for this role.
- Previous experience working in secure or government environments is a plus.
